The postcode HP14 3AB is located in Buckinghamsh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. HP14 3AB is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
HP14 3AB is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of HP14 3AB as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.
The closest road name to HP14 3AB is High Street which is centered 78 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Village Hall and is 17 m away. The closest railway station is Saunderton Rail Station, 3.86 km away.
The closest primary school to HP14 3AB (for ages 11 and under) is West Wycombe School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Unity College. The last OFSTED inspection on September 28, 2017 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of HP14 3AB is George & Dragon Hotel and is 0 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on November 6,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from A.B.M Catering Ltd - Kiosks At Wycombe Wanderers FC and is 1.5 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on September 13, 2019.
Residents reported an average download speed of 52.3 Mbps and an average upload speed of 11.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.8 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for HP14 3AB is covered by the Thames Valley police force association and Buckinghamsh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
